About This School

Dufur School is a public high in Dufur, Oregon, serving 352 students in grades K-12. Academic results show that students demonstrate proficiency levels of 52% in ELA and 32% in math. The school maintains a student-teacher ratio of 17:1 with 20 teachers on staff, while the average teacher salary is $75,125. The student body at Dufur School is 56% male and 44% female. Regarding ethnicity, the population is 79% White, 8% Hispanic, 5% Two or More Races, and 1% Black.
